** The Mercedes-Benz repair market accessible to Kerman residents is centered in Fresno, located approximately 15-20 miles away. The market is characterized by a handful of high-quality, independent specialists who compete directly with the sole Mercedes-Benz dealership in the region. The competition level is moderate but specialized, ensuring that shops must maintain high standards of expertise to retain their clientele. **Average Quality:** The quality of top-tier independent specialists is very high, often exceeding that of dealerships in terms of personalized service and value. These shops employ certified master technicians with direct Mercedes-Benz training. **Competition Level:** The market is not saturated with general mechanics willing to work on complex Mercedes systems. True expertise is concentrated in a few dedicated shops, which creates a competitive environment focused on technical capability and customer service rather than price undercutting. **Typical Pricing:** Labor rates are premium, typically ranging from $165 to $195 per hour, reflecting the specialized training and equipment required. However, these rates are generally 15-25% lower than the local dealership. Parts sourcing from both OEM and high-quality aftermarket suppliers allows these independents to offer significant cost savings on repairs while maintaining quality.

The intense heat and pervasive dust accelerate wear on cooling systems and air filters. It is crucial to have your cooling system, including the radiator, hoses, and thermostat, inspected regularly to prevent overheating. Additionally, cabin air and engine air filters may need more frequent replacement to maintain performance and air quality.
Beyond climate-related cooling issues, common repairs include suspension component wear from rough rural roads and highway commuting, and electrical/electronic module issues which are complex for all modern Mercedes models. Air suspension failures on certain models are also a frequent concern that local specialists are familiar with diagnosing.
For routine maintenance like oil changes, brake service, or tire rotations, a trusted local independent shop in Fresno can be more convenient and cost-effective. For major warranty work, complex electronic diagnoses, or recalls, the authorized dealership is necessary to ensure specialized software and genuine parts are used correctly.
Yes, Mercedes-Benz repairs typically have a higher cost due to the need for specialized training, advanced diagnostic equipment, and premium parts. However, building a relationship with a qualified independent specialist can provide significant savings over the dealership while maintaining quality, especially for older models out of warranty.
